Borewell drilling in Tirupur involves navigating the complex crystalline basement of the Indian Peninsular Shield. The geological profile here is dominated by ancient Granite and Gneiss, which are known for their extreme hardness and lack of primary porosity. In Tirupur, groundwater is primarily stored within secondary fractures, fissures, and weathered zones (Murrum). Our drilling process utilizes high-pressure DTH (Down-the-Hole) hammers capable of penetrating these dense formations at significant depths. Because the water-bearing 'veins' are localized, we often recommend a professional geophysical survey to pinpoint the most productive fracture zones. We utilize heavy-duty button bits to ensure straight-hole verticality even in tilted rock layers. For long-term sustainability in Tirupur, we advise installing high-stage stainless steel submersible pumps designed to handle deep-head pressure. Our team ensures that the top weathered layer is properly cased with MS or UPVC pipes to prevent surface water contamination and borehole collapse. Tirupur, globally recognized as the "Knitting City," faces a unique and pressing water challenge. The district's economy is heavily anchored by the textile and garment industries, which are notoriously water-intensive. While the Noyyal River traverses the region, it is largely seasonal and has historically faced significant pollution issues, making surface water unreliable for high-quality production or safe domestic use. In the bustling urban centers of Tirupur South, Avinashi, and Palladam, the water dependency on underground aquifers is nearly absolute. The rapid pace of industrialization and urban expansion in areas like Nallur and P.N. Road has led to a critical lowering of the water table. Consequently, a borewell is an indispensable infrastructure for residential complexes, dyeing units, and the peripheral agricultural belts of Dharapuram and Kangayam, serving as the only perennial backup to the intermittent municipal and tanker supplies.

Find the borewell cost for your land based on the state, city, and locality. The cost estimate for a borewell tends to vary from area to area. For example, the borewell cost in a village is not the same as the cost in a city. It also depends on factors such as the accessibility of the borewell point, the type of soil (rock or loose soil), labor rates in the locality, PVC pipe and lid prices, and the availability of borewell equipment nearby.
